Dear Ma,

Finished work early today so I thought I would write you now so I can mail it when I go to supper. Tomorrow is suppose to be the big opening of the new mess hall. The way I understand it I have to work every other day helping the regular cooks after so long so I am suppose to be a cook. Don’t know whether I will make it or not but it is worth a trial.

Didn’t get any mail today for it hasn’t all been transfered from the other camp yet.

Bought myself a sewing kit today an am figuring on doing a little sewing one of these days. Have a few buttons to sew on.

My address is changed now to what it is suppose to be for awhile. The box number now is 48. Have the papers changed to this.

Well ma guess I will close now an write Beryle a few lines.

Love
Howard
